What Causes Hip Pain?

Hip pain can occur for several reasons. The hip joint is involved in many daily movements, including walking, running, sitting, standing, and climbing stairs. Problems affecting the muscles, joints, tendons, or surrounding tissues can lead to pain and restricted movement.

Common causes of hip pain may include:

  • Muscle strains and injuries
  • Joint stiffness
  • Sports-related injuries
  • Overuse of the hip muscles
  • Weak hip and core muscles
  • Poor posture and movement patterns
  • Tendon-related conditions
  • Arthritis and age-related joint changes
  • Pain referred from the lower back
  • Reduced hip mobility

A proper physiotherapy assessment can help identify movement limitations and determine the most suitable treatment approach.

Common Symptoms of Hip Pain

Hip pain can feel different for each person. Some people experience sharp pain, while others may notice stiffness, weakness, or a constant ache around the hip area.

Common symptoms include:

  • Pain while walking
  • Difficulty climbing stairs
  • Hip stiffness
  • Reduced range of motion
  • Pain while sitting or standing for long periods
  • Discomfort while sleeping
  • Weakness around the hip
  • Difficulty exercising
  • Pain during daily activities
  • Tightness around the hip and thigh

1. Detailed Assessment

The first step is understanding your condition. Your physiotherapist may assess your hip movement, posture, muscle strength, walking pattern, flexibility, and functional limitations.

This helps create a personalised treatment plan based on your specific needs.

2. Pain Management

Appropriate physiotherapy techniques can help manage discomfort and make movement more comfortable. The treatment approach depends on your symptoms and the underlying cause of your hip pain.

3. Manual Therapy

Manual therapy techniques may be used to improve joint mobility and reduce stiffness. These techniques can support better movement when combined with appropriate therapeutic exercises.

4. Mobility and Stretching Exercises

Reduced hip mobility can affect walking and other everyday activities. Specific mobility and stretching exercises may help improve flexibility and movement around the hip joint.

Your physiotherapist can recommend exercises that are suitable for your individual condition.

5. Strengthening Exercises

Strong hip muscles are important for stability and movement. A physiotherapy programme may include exercises to strengthen the hip, thigh, gluteal, and core muscles.

Improving muscle strength can help support the hip during everyday activities and physical exercise.

6. Functional Rehabilitation

Functional rehabilitation focuses on improving movements used in daily life. This may include training for walking, climbing stairs, sitting, standing, and returning to regular activities.

The goal is to help you move with greater confidence and comfort.

When Should You Consult a Physiotherapist for Hip Pain?

You should consider a physiotherapy assessment if hip pain continues for several days, becomes worse, or affects your ability to perform normal activities.

Professional guidance may be helpful if you experience:

  • Persistent hip pain
  • Increasing stiffness
  • Difficulty walking
  • Reduced hip movement
  • Pain while exercising
  • Difficulty climbing stairs
  • Weakness around the hip

Early assessment can help identify movement problems and provide guidance on the most appropriate rehabilitation approach.
